Assessment of expertise in morphological identification of mosquito species (Diptera, Culicidae) using photomicrographs

Abstract: Accurate identification of insect species is an indispensable and challenging requirement for every entomologist, particularly if the species is involved in disease outbreaks. The European MediLabSecure project designed an identification (ID) exercise available to any willing participant with the aim of assessing and improving knowledge in mosquito taxonomy. The exercise was based on high-definition photomicrographs of mosquitoes (26 adult females and 12 larvae) collected from the western Palaearctic. Sixty-fi… Show more

“…The use of additional equipment and the dissection of internal structures are also sometimes necessary to distinguish between morphologically close species, as for Culex mosquitoes, in which meticulous dissection of male genitalia is required (de Sá et al., 2020 ; Sallum & Forattini, 1996 ). Moreover, even with properly trained and experienced professionals the task frequently remains a challenge, misidentifications are common (Rahola et al., 2022 ) and results cannot be double checked in case of doubt once samples have been processed in a destructive treatment. Finally, it requires physical manipulations that are not always compatible with experiments requiring fast sampling of specimens on the field, for instance, for OMIC analyses.…”
